Women In Sales: Closing the Gender Gap

May 14, 2023 By Community Member

women in sales

According to recent research, 29.5% of all salespeople are women, while 70.5% are men. And yet, according to a Harvard Business Review study, women are the ones who are outperforming their male counterparts – with 86% achieving quota, compared to 78% of men. No Progress for Women in Business Says 2013 Census of Fortune 500

December 21, 2013 By Susan Gunelius

The results of the Catalyst 2013 Census of Fortune 500 Women Board Directors and 2013 Census of Fortune 500 Women Executive Officers and Top Earners were released this month along with a clear but disturbing message, "Still no progress after years of no progress." 71 Years to Gender Equality in Top Chicago Companies

November 22, 2013 By Susan Gunelius

equality

The Chicago 50 2013 Census Report from The Chicago Network reveals that it will take 71 years for men and women to have equal representation in the boardrooms and executive positions at Chicago's 50 largest publicly-traded companies.
